This comes amid months of tension between Billie and Taylor’s fandoms amid an alleged feud between the two.

Last month, Billie was accused of defaming Taylor amid their battle for the top spot on the Billboard album chart following the release of their respective albums.

While the superstars have publicly praised each other in the past, some social media users are convinced the pair are feuding following an interview Eilish gave this week, in which she called the three-hour concerts “psychotic.”

While appearing at Stationhead following the recent release of her new album, the singer criticised musicians who play shows that are too long.

“Nobody wants that. You guys don’t want that. I don’t want that. I don’t even want that as a fan,” the Bad Guy hitmaker said. “My favorite artist in the world, I’m not trying to listen to him for three hours.”

The comments sent Swifties into a frenzy, rushing to defend the 14-time Grammy winner, whose Eras Tour shows average three hours and 15 minutes.

Similarly, Beyoncé’s Renaissance World Tour, which ended in September, lasted between two and a half and three hours.

Interestingly, last year, Eilish praised both Swift and Beyoncé for being able to “put on such a long show” that is “filled with so many amazing moments” for their fans.

During that interview with the Los Angeles TimesHe also referred to Swift as an “untouchable superstar.”

Eilish’s latest comments come just two months after she gained attention for criticizing artists who release multiple editions of their albums on vinyl.

The vocal climate activist slammed how “wasteful” it is for “some of the biggest artists in the world” to make “40 different fucking vinyl bundles that have something unique and different just so you keep buying more.”

Despite never naming Swift or any artist in particular, fans interpreted his comments as an attack on the Fortnight singer, as she has released numerous vinyl versions of her albums.

During his interview with the Billboard In March, Billie slammed artists for the “wasteful” practice of releasing numerous vinyl versions of albums to boost sales.

Swift has not publicly commented on any of Eilish’s comments, but has previously shown support for the Gen Z sensation’s career.
